Product Information
| Description | Propargyl-O-C1-amido-PEG2-C2-NHS ester combines alkyne functionality with PEG2 spacer and NHS ester, enabling click chemistry and amine-targeted payload conjugation. It supports precise and stable antibody-drug conjugate assembly. |
